There are numerous benefits to LASIK surgery. The most obvious is improved vision. Many individuals who have had the procedure report a noticeable improvement in vision shortly following the surgery. Patients report that they no longer need glasses or contact lenses to correct their vision.
The risks associated with the procedure are quite low. LASIK surgery carries a very low risk of serious postoperative complications. Additionally, the procedure is minimally invasive, with just a tiny incision made in the cornea under local anesthesia. Since the surgical portion of the procedure is so brief, most people will feel little or no discomfort.
